The World Is Stuck Between Trump and China

The world is currently being held hostage, and not just by the coronavirus. This is because the question of how well we manage to get through the crisis depends on China and the U.S. – the world’s two superpowers. In the shadow of the pandemic, they have declared a propaganda war on each other while the rest of the world has been shackled to their spectator seats. In one corner is an increasingly bitter Donald Trump, and in the other corner, the communist dictator of a totalitarian regime in the form of Xi Jinping.

Trump is increasingly firm in believing the theory which holds that the coronavirus originated in a Chinese lab in Wuhan—whether or not it was spread on purpose—is correct. Trump’s secretary of state, Mike Pompeo also supports the theory, and in an interview with ABC, claimed to have “enormous evidence” of it, even though neither Pompeo nor Trump have shared this evidence. American intelligence agencies have confirmed no information about a leak from a Chinese lab; rather it’s quite the opposite. The existence of any such evidence has been denied.

Getting Coverage in Sweden

Nevertheless, the theory is still getting coverage, even in the Swedish media, as if it were simply facts from some source. It is not that simple, of course.

The speculation concerning the Wuhan lab constitutes America’s biggest attack on China so far, with the aim of both directing attention away from its own handling of the crisis and further securing American influence on world politics. Just as China sees the coronavirus crisis as a chance to strengthen its global position, the U.S. sees a risk of losing its own. America’s fear is justified. Most things look good when placed next to Trump, but we cannot be fooled into thinking that China belongs in this category.

Scientists are relatively united in their view that the likely origin of the coronavirus came from bats, which managed to spread the virus to humans through another animal. It would not be the first or the last time this has happened. However, we still cannot be certain, as we still do not know enough, and China is not showing us all its cards.

On Monday, there were reports that China had purposely hidden information about how far the coronavirus had spread in order to give them enough time to reset and prepare the necessary resources for health care. That is a very serious charge, and currently, it is more believable than theories about leaks from a lab.

We need an independent investigation and additional research to get to the truth of how our world leaders have handled the crisis. Decades are likely to pass before the fog lifts. Before that time, we are likely to see more of the information war between China and the U.S. Under such circumstances, we must not forget that Trump does not become more reliable because he manipulates China. The sad truth is that these days we cannot trust anyone.
